Hair Loss/Patch
I recently got a bald patch on my head, it just appeared a week ago. The hair surrounding to the bald patch are also very weak now, if i just try to pull some hair near to the patch a lot of them would just come off without even pulling them hard. I am very scared now, i have been having some hairfall since last 3-4 months but i guess it was mostly because of the hard water of Gurgaon and yes i started smoking couple of months ago which i quitted completely 2-3 weeks ago. (If this info helps)

You are having alopecia areata. this is an autoimmune condition due to the attack of lymphocytes​ against hair roots. It results in the formation of bald patches on the scalp. It can affect any hairy area of the body like scalp, eyebrows and  beard. It has to be treated properly for long duration until the immunity comes down.
